.c-person__picture {
width: 100%;
flex: auto;
display: block;
}
.c-person__img {
object-fit: cover;
width: 100%;
height: 100%;
background-color: palette(neutral, 200);
}
.c-person__info {
padding: space(2);
background-color: palette(neutral, 300);
}
.c-person__title {
font-size: 1.2rem;
color: palette(neutral, 600);
}
.c-person__subtitle {
font-size: 0.75rem;
color: palette(neutral, 500);
}